    I have installed wordpress mu site tamilblogs.com . Installation went thro fine. I checked with my service provider hostgator.com and they told they have enabled mod_rewrite and also setup wildcard DNS for my domain.

    Now when i try to create a new blog, Message says new blog has been created at URL mugunth.tamilblogs.com but i am not able to access the mugunth.tamilblogs.com .

    Please advice How to resolve this problem.

    Also advice how to check if wildcard DNS for my domain is setup.

    PING tamilblogs.com (70.86.12.194): 56 data bytes
    64 bytes from 70.86.12.194: icmp_seq=0 ttl=52 time=17.691 ms

    So the wildcard DNS is working and in fact http://mugunth.tamilblogs.com/ actually loads for me so I'd say your DNS just needs to be updated, try an ipconfig /flushdns or just wait for it to propagate.

    I have the same problem. I have installed wpmu, and all seems fine with that.

    If I create a new blog, a) I don't receive an email giving login details and b) the subdomain doesn't seem to work.

    My DNS records have the * entry (it was done a few days ago so that should have progogated now). My server has mod-rewrite installed, and the blog that I created is listed in wpmu as being there!

    The only thing I am wondering is whether the ServerAlias has been setup properly. My server is running Plesk, and it was recommended to me to create a file called vhost.conf in /home/https/$domain.com/conf and put the line in it :

    ServerAlias *.domain.com

    I created this file in the path /home/httpd/vhosts/selectablog.com/conf and entered the line as above (but with selectablog.com instead of domain.com, as that is my domain)

    The server has been restarted since then, but it doesn't seem to have made a difference to me trying to get to my test blog.

    Actually, I have this sorted. I was correct in my assumption above, and probably should have Googled first.

    The page at http://faq.sw-soft.com/article_41_894_en.html has information on restarting apache after making the changes. I guess a reboot didn't reconfigure it - had to do this manually.
